BatiUp is an AI voice answering assistant built for construction tradespeople in France, with the main goal of reducing missed customer calls. It provides a France-specific phone number, 24/7 voice answering, caller information collection, request queues, and notifications. The site positions it as a lower-cost alternative to outsourcing reception work or hiring an in-house secretary.
Functionally, BatiUp is more than a standard voicemail service. It is tailored to construction workflows, with scenario-based categories such as quotes, emergency repairs, active job sites, after-sales service, urgent issues, and general inquiries. Pro and above support SMS notifications, one-click replies, automated SMS, collecting customer files by email, emergency detection, daily summaries, and priority filtering. Premium further adds custom rules, AI scoring, multilingual support, and a dedicated contact. Typical users include small tradespeople and multi-team service providers who cannot answer calls while on-site, driving, or working.
Pricing is fairly transparent, with a 14-day free trial and no credit card required. Essentiel is 49€ excl. VAT/month when billed annually, including 100 minutes and 2 concurrent calls. Pro is 99€ excl. VAT/month annually, including 300 minutes and 5 concurrent calls. Premium is 199€ excl. VAT/month annually, including 800 minutes and 10 concurrent calls. Monthly billing costs 59€, 119€, and 239€ excl. VAT/month respectively. Overage minutes are charged at 0.20€, 0.15€, and 0.10€ respectively. Annual billing includes a 2-month discount.
Its strengths are a clear vertical-industry focus, and fairly explicit plan details covering included minutes, concurrency, and recording retention. The no-credit-card trial lowers the cost of evaluation. For small teams, the SMS features, categorization, emergency detection, and summaries in Pro/Premium can be genuinely useful. Limitations include the lack of disclosure around the underlying AI model, speech recognition accuracy, privacy and compliance details, data hosting location, and any API or CRM integrations. Chinese is not listed among the supported languages; Premium only mentions French, English, Spanish, Arabic, and Turkish.
BatiUp is best suited to local construction tradespeople, repair service providers, and construction teams in France that need French-language call handling.
